Central Oregon Real Estate Market Update: June 1, 2026

The Central Oregon housing market is entering a new chapter. After years of historically low inventory and rapid price escalation, the market is finding its footing — and for savvy buyers and sellers, that creates real opportunity.

Here's a breakdown of what's happening right now in Sisters, Bend, and Redmond.


Bend: More Inventory, Smarter Buyers

Bend remains the heartbeat of Central Oregon real estate, and right now it's telling an important story.

Inventory has climbed to 714 active listings — a 44% increase since March — giving buyers the most selection they've seen in years. The median sale price came in at $682,000 last month, reflecting a 7.9% decrease year-over-year as the market recalibrates from its pandemic-era highs.

That said, well-positioned homes are still performing well. Properties priced between $579,000 and $765,000 are attracting serious buyers and going under contract in 35 to 49 days. The homes sitting on the market? Nearly 39% of active listings have taken a price reduction — a signal that sellers who priced to last year's market are now adjusting to today's reality.

What this means for buyers: Conditions haven't been this favorable in years. More inventory, less competition, and motivated sellers open to negotiation. If you've been waiting, your patience is paying off.

What this means for sellers: A great outcome is still very achievable — but it starts with pricing right from day one. Homes that are priced competitively and show well are still closing. Homes that aren't are watching days on market pile up.


Sisters: A Premium Market Being Selective

Sisters has always played by its own rules, and 2026 is no different. This is a lifestyle market, and the buyers who seek it out are discerning, financially capable, and in no rush.

Median sale prices have ranged from $552,000 to $677,500 over recent months, with the variation reflecting how sensitive a boutique market can be to individual transactions. Days on market have extended, giving buyers ample time to evaluate their options.

This isn't a distressed market — far from it. It's simply one where buyers are exercising the patience they now have the luxury of using.

What this means for buyers: Deliberate, informed offers are being received well. Take your time, ask questions, and negotiate confidently.

What this means for sellers: Presentation is paramount. In a market where buyers aren't rushing, the homes that win are the ones that feel move-in ready and are priced to reflect today's conditions, not yesterday's.


Redmond: Central Oregon's Best Value Play

Redmond continues to be the most accessible and arguably most underappreciated market in the region. With a median home price hovering between $499,000 and $524,000 — essentially flat year-over-year — Redmond offers meaningful value in a region where affordability is increasingly scarce.

Home values have softened slightly (down about 5.6% over the past year), but demand remains steady, fueled by first-time buyers priced out of Bend, remote workers seeking a lower cost of entry, and investors drawn to Redmond's long-term growth story.

What this means for buyers: Redmond offers the best dollars-per-square-foot value in Central Oregon right now. Whether you're buying your first home or adding to a portfolio, current conditions are as favorable as they've been in years.

What this means for sellers: Lean into your home's strengths — condition, location, and lifestyle amenities. The story of Redmond's growth trajectory is a compelling one, and the right agent knows how to tell it.


The Central Oregon Outlook

Across Sisters, Bend, and Redmond, one theme is clear: balance is returning to the market. Buyers have more time, more choices, and more negotiating power than they've had since before the pandemic. Sellers who price strategically and prepare their homes well are succeeding. Those clinging to peak-market expectations are waiting — and often netting less in the end.

The fundamentals that make Central Oregon special — world-class outdoor recreation, a growing regional economy, a quality of life that's hard to match — haven't changed. The market has simply matured.
